Microsoft Flow now supports parallel execution of Flows, adds five new services

0
Microsoft Flow

Microsoft has updated its Flow automation service with a new feature. Microsoft Flow is a great tool for building sequential flows, along with conditional logic. Until now, all the steps you add to the flow execute sequentially or one after the other. Today, Microsoft is announcing that Flow now supports parallel execution as well.

Parallel execution is the ability where you can run two or more steps in a flow, simultaneously,  after which the workflow will only proceed once all parallel steps have completed.

Microsoft has also added five new services to the ever growing list of supported services.

Five new services supported

  • Approvals – With our modern approvals experiences, you can quickly create an approval workflow for your data in SharePoint, Dynamics CRM, Twitter, Visual Studio Team Services, MailChimp and many others. As part of the approval process, approvers will receive email notifications about pending approvals, and can view and respond to all approval requests in a brand-new, unified approvals center.
  • Benchmark Email – Online email marketing solution to engage subscribers, target an audience, send beautiful, responsive emails and track results.
  • Capsule CRM – Online CRM for individuals, small businesses and sales teams wanting a simple, effective and affordable solution.
  • LiveChat – LiveChat is an online customer service software with live support, help desk software and web analytics capabilities.
  • Outlook Customer Manager – Outlook Customer Manager helps you to graduate from managing contacts to building relationships. It is part of the Office365 Business Premium subscription.
